### Lost Badges — What To Do

It happens more often than you'd think! When someone turns up at the desk badge-less, first check the lost-property drawer — about half the "lost" badges at Tollgate House end up there. If it's genuinely gone, log it in the access book and issue a day pass from the top drawer, valid until midnight. The old badge gets deactivated automatically once you log it. To activate the day pass at the kiosk, enter the reception override code below.

turnstile pass: bdg-NG-3

Summary: Proctoring queue in Examgate stalls when more than 40 candidates join within one minute. Sessions stay in "awaiting reviewer" indefinitely; manual requeue works. Affects the Brindlemoor campus pilot only. Support can apply the requeue workaround until the patch ships. For escalations, reference the affected build using the identifier below.

pipeline stamp: htk9_6ce9d33c5

## Changed defaults — GraphQL N+1 fix (Quibbler API)

Future maintainers, hello. We finally squashed the N+1 mess on the Quibbler API: the resolver for nested collections was firing one query per child, which melted the database whenever someone requested a deep tree. The fix batches child lookups through the new dataloader layer, and the defaults changed accordingly — batching is now on everywhere, and per-request query caps are lower. Don't flip these back without profiling first. The defaults as shipped are as follows.

deployment values, kagap-hahif:
[queneth]
port = 5672
region = south-4
host = queneth.qirvantech.local
team = istir
timeout_ms = 1500
retries = 2

## Document Transport: Loaned Exhibition Pieces

The three framed textile works on loan from the Verlane Atelier must travel in the padded flat-case, accompanied by their condition reports and the signed loan agreement. Please confirm the climate log is sealed inside the outer sleeve before the courier from Harwick Fine Transit arrives at the Delmore Annex. The confidential hand-over instruction for the courier is as follows.

dispatch memo: the ulaox normir courier leaves the praath ledger at gate 9753 under passcode 639705